Saudi Aramco Shell Refinery (SASREF) has awarded a $95 million eng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) contract to US-based CB&I to modernize and expand its refinery in Jubail.
CB&I said in a statement that it has completed the conceptual design and front-end engineering design (FEED) phases of the project, while working with SASREF to optimise investment on the new refinery configuration.
“The relationship between CB&I and SASREF extends back for more than a decade, and we have been collaborating successfully during this time,” said Duncan Wigney, CB&I's Executive Vice President of Engineering & Construction.
SASREF is a joint venture between Saudi Aramco and Shell, two of the world’s biggest oil and gas companies.
